Unleashing the Multitasking Monster: Two Methods Await!

Now, here's where things get exciting (or slightly confusing, depending on your level of iPad expertise). There are two ways to activate split-screen on your iPad Pro:

  • Method 1: The Three-Dot Trinity

    1. Open your first app, the one you want to be your split-screen soulmate.
    2. Look up at the top of the screen. See those three little dots grouped together in a non-threatening way? That, my friend, is the Multitasking button. Tap it gently.
    3. Behold! A magical menu appears. Look for the Split View option (it might be hiding behind another icon, but don't worry, they all have friendly faces). Give it a tap.
    4. Now comes the fun part: choosing your second app. Your iPad will helpfully display compatible apps you can use in split-screen. Pick your champion and tap away!
  • Method 2: The Dock Duo

    1. Open your first app, just like in Method 1.
    2. Swipe up from the bottom of your screen with one finger. This, my friends, is the Dock, a haven for your most-used apps.
    3. Find the app you want to join the split-screen party. Tap and hold on its icon.
    4. With the app icon firmly in your grasp (don't worry, it's not going anywhere), drag it towards the left or right side of your screen. Let go, and voila! Split-screen activated.

Now you have two glorious apps side-by-side, ready to tackle whatever multitasking mayhem you throw their way!

Pro Tip: Feeling a little cramped? You can adjust the size of each app in split-screen by dragging the black bar in the middle. Slide it left or right to give one app more breathing room.

Frequently Asked Split-Screen Questions (Because We Know You Have Them)

1. How to close split-screen?

Easy! Drag the black bar all the way to the left or right side of the screen, and the other app will disappear like a magician's trick.

2. How to use two of the same app in split-screen?

Some apps allow you to have two instances open at once. In Method 1, after tapping Split View, you can swipe through all your open apps to see if the one you want allows duplicates.

3. How to switch between apps in split-screen?

Just tap on the app you want to use, and it will come to the foreground.

4. How do I know which apps work with split-screen?

Most apps will work in split-screen, but some might not. Just try the methods above, and your iPad will tell you if it's an option.

5. Can I have more than two apps open at once?

Yes, but not in true split-screen. You can use Slide Over, which lets you have a third app open in a smaller window that peeks in from the side. But for now, let's master split-screen first!
